The Cake Zone is a location in PokéPark 2: Wonders Beyond. It is one of the four zones in Wish Park and connects with Seasong Beach. The attraction manager in this zone is Cofagrigus.

Story

Pikachu and Piplup visit the Cake Zone after hearing about it from Krokorok and Sandile. When they arrive, they explore and play the zone's attraction, Cake Contraption. However, before they can eat the cake they made in the attraction, a Pansear warns them that whoever eats the cake falls under a trance. Cofagrigus appears and force feeds some cake to Pansear, putting him into a trance, but Oshawott, who was investigating disappearing Pokémon, arrives and prevents him from doing the same to Pikachu and Piplup. Suddenly, Cofagrigus' master's voice booms throughout the zone and declares none shall leave Wish Park and two giant arms appear and try to trap Pikachu, Oshawott, and Piplup inside. Piplup pushes Pikachu and Oshawott back into the PokéPark at the cost of being captured.

Later, Pikachu and Oshawott return to save the kidnapped Pokémon. After clearing Cofagrigus' attraction a second time, and defeating him and his Yamask, the two ring the Zone's Wish Bell, freeing the kidnapped Pokémon from their trance. However, Piplup is nowhere to be found and Cofagrigus reveals there are multiple zones in Wish Park, but a Gothorita arrives to keep him from spilling any more secrets. Gothorita explains that the master of Wish Park desires to keep Pokémon entranced with it forever and interference will be not accepted before leaving with Cofagrigus.

Attraction

Cake Contraption

Cake Contraption

Cake Contraption is an attraction with two stages. The first stage has Patrat and Watchog popping out of holes holding nuts. Players must aim the Wii Remote target above the nuts and fire using the "A" button to destroy it and earn points. More points are earned depending on which color of nut: green is worth the fewest, red is worth more, and gold is worth the most. After the first stage ends the attraction moves on to the second stage. The second stage has Audino throwing globs of cake dough into the air that slowly fall down the screen. Like earlier, players must aim the Wii Remote target above the cake globs and fire. The first time they are hit, the globs turn into cake, give points and rise up a little bit, allowing time to hit the same target again. The second time the cake is hit, it becomes decorated and gives an extra set of points. Players continue firing in both stages until time runs out.

Boss Battle

The boss battle with Cofagrigus is conducted in two stages. In the first stage, the player must destroy a giant cake tower that Cofagrigus is standing on. The tower can be damaged by attacking it, but Cofagrigus and his Yamask minions will appear and attack the player. After the two are destroyed, the player will face Cofagrigus in a one-on-one battle.
